Overview
- Nicole’s X account was deleted on Nov. 6 after users circulated screenshots of posts from the early 2010s described as racist, homophobic, sexist and ableist.
- The scrutiny followed her Oct. 31 video recreating Toni Braxton’s “He Wasn’t Man Enough,” which many viewers read as a jab tied to her past with Travis Kelce and his engagement to Taylor Swift.
- On her Pre-Game podcast, Nicole said the inspiration was a childhood memory involving a friend named Taylor, distancing the post from Swift.
- Swift fans drove much of the resurfacing and criticism, while some specifics of the alleged posts and their attribution varied across reports.
- Outlets noted conflicting claims about whether her Instagram was also deactivated, and there were no substantive public responses from Swift or Kelce.
